Berkshire won this return match by 3 wickets on the second day. The match between the two sides at Bletchley in July had been won by Berkshire. For the winners Brougham scored 122 which contained 22 fours. Lockhart and Hawksworth added 66 runs for the last wicket in the first innings. Lockhart took 10 wickets in the match for 183 runs including 6 for 104 in the Buckinghamshire first innings.
For Buckinghamshire Shaw scored 57 which included 1 six and 8 fours and Leat scored 51 not out with 4 sixes and 5 fours. Wright took 9 wickets in the match for 79 runs. The match finished in an unusual way with Lockhart hitting a catch to point but as a no ball had been called it proved to be the winning run.
